Hippocampus
A major part of the brain involved in learning and memory.
Medulla
A part of the brainstem that controls vital bodily functions such as heart rate, breathing, and blood pressure.
Biological Clock
An internal mechanism in organisms that regulates biological rhythms and cycles, such as sleep-wake cycles, often in response to environmental cues.
Hypothalamus
A region of the brain responsible for producing hormones that regulate essential bodily functions, including temperature, hunger, and sleep.
